Odaily Planet Daily News: According to crypto analyst Yu Jin@EmberCN monitoring, about 60,000 ETH were transferred to Coinbase after being redeemed from Ethereum staking approximately 3 hours ago, worth about $129 million; this batch of assets may belong to DARMA Capital co-founder Andrew Keys.

On-chain data shows that in May 2021, he previously deposited about 90,000 ETH into staking in multiple batches. Recently, he redeemed them in a concentrated manner and consolidated and transferred them out. Over roughly a 5-year staking cycle, he accumulated about 16,000 ETH in rewards, corresponding to about an 18% coin-denominated return; its current value is about $34.2 million.
